Overview of LCMXO2-2000HE-4TG144C – MachXO2 FPGA — 2112 Logic Elements, 144-LQFP

The LCMXO2-2000HE-4TG144C is a MachXO2 family Field Programmable Gate Array (FPGA) device in a 144‑lead LQFP surface mount package. It provides 2,112 logic elements, 111 user I/Os and on-chip non-volatile configuration capability, making it suitable for space-constrained, low-power programmable-logic applications.

Designed with a flexible logic architecture and a broad I/O feature set, this device targets designs that require integrated glue logic, interface control and low-power programmable functionality. Key electrical and environmental parameters include a supply voltage range of 1.14 V to 1.26 V and an operating temperature range of 0 °C to 85 °C.

Key Features

  • Core Logic — 2,112 logic elements for implementing combinational and sequential logic functions and system glue logic.
  • On-chip Memory — Total on-chip RAM of 75,776 bits; the MachXO2 family also provides embedded block RAM and distributed RAM options for buffering and small data storage.
  • I/O — 111 user I/Os with the family’s programmable sysIO™ buffer supporting a wide range of standards and programmable differential/low‑voltage signaling.
  • Non-volatile Configuration — MachXO2 family devices include on-chip user Flash memory and instant-on, single-chip reconfigurable operation with background programming support.
  • Low Power — MachXO2 family is built on an advanced low-power process with family features for very low standby power and power-saving modes.
  • Clocking and PLLs — Family-level flexible clocking with multiple primary clocks and PLL options for fractional-n frequency synthesis.
  • Package and Mounting — Surface-mount 144‑LQFP; supplier device package reference 144‑TQFP (20 × 20 mm) for compact PCB implementation.
  • Electrical and Thermal — Supply voltage 1.14 V to 1.26 V; commercial-grade operating temperature range 0 °C to 85 °C.
  • Standards and System Support — Family includes on-chip peripherals (SPI, I2C, timer/counter), JTAG and in-system programming support; RoHS compliant.
